Surendera Dental College and Research Institute (SDCRI), situated in Sri Ganganagar, Rajasthan, is widely recognized for its contributions to dental education and healthcare in the region. Established in 1999, SDCRI has steadily built a reputation as a leading institution affiliated with the prestigious Rajasthan University of Health Sciences, Jaipur. The college campus spans 35 acres, providing a conducive environment for academic pursuits and student life. SDCRI offers a comprehensive range of dental programs, including the Bachelor of Dental Surgery (BDS) and various specializations under the Master of Dental Surgery (MDS). The BDS program is designed to equip students with fundamental knowledge and practical skills, while the MDS program offers advanced training across nine distinct specializations such as Oral & Maxillofacial Surgery, Prosthodontics, Orthodontics, and Periodontics. The institution boasts 13 well-equipped academic departments, each fostering specialized learning and research under the guidance of experienced faculty. Admissions to SDCRI's highly sought-after dental courses are primarily based on performance in the NEET (National Eligibility Cum Entrance Test), ensuring that only meritorious students gain entry.
